How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Clanton Park?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Clanton Park Studio Apartments | $1,517 | $909 | $2,649 |
Clanton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,795 | $700 | $5,200 |
Clanton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,462 | $830 | $9,700 |
Clanton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,108 | $1,175 | $10,000+ |
Clanton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,209 | $1,500 | $4,000 |

Getting Around the Clanton Park Neighborhood in Charlotte, NC
Walk Score®
15 / 100
Car-Dependent
Almost all errands require a car
Bike Score®
12 / 100
Somewhat Bikeable
Minimal b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
40 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
